posts tagged as IEA
-
September 2010
Or Are New Coal Plants Dead? According to statistics from the Energy Information Administration (EIA), there were few new coal-fired plants constructed...
Or Are New Coal Plants Dead? According to statistics from the Energy Information Administration (EIA), there were few new coal-fired plants constructed...